Having a brain fart moment. Does the angle go toward the center or to the outside of the transom?
http://img32.imageshack.us/img32/6100/44247187.jpg
Toward the center, it allows you to mount them closer to the drive without blowing the prop out.

Just took a better look at the tabs!!!! They are the same basic design as the Arneson rocker plates, the plate bends instead of using a hinge. They mount perfectly flush with the bottom of the boat. They are power up and down when you raise them they help to lift the bow. From some previous discussions they can cause some problems making the boat hook in turns, I think you should get some more input before taking the advice in my first post. They may have been cut to alleviate the hooking issue! You will need two separate trim pumps to use them. You may be ahead of the game shopping some regular tabs.
